some months ago (sometime last year) I built this 2x2x1 with LEGO. At that time I didn't know about any 2x2x1 mech, so I came up with my own

(I later realized it was one of the simplest and most common-used mechs ever...) I used the simple covering-the-middle-layer-of-a-1x2x3-mech. The mech is easy to come up with, but to build it in LEGO is harder

To make the two half cylinders inside I used
eight technic curved panels that I got from the
crane truck.
It took some hours to build it.
The turning is horrible, and the color-scheme is 'wrong', but it's fully functional
